Proper Training and Certification

Phlebotomy, the practice of drawing blood from patients for analysis, requires proper training and certification. Phlebotomists are trained professionals who specialize in blood collection and processing. It is essential for phlebotomists to be certified by an accredited organization to ensure that they have the necessary knowledge and skills to perform their duties effectively.

Key points to remember:

  1. Phlebotomists should be certified by an accredited organization.
  2. Regular training and Continuing Education programs should be attended to stay up-to-date with the latest techniques and guidelines.
  3. Proper documentation of training and certification should be maintained.

Collection Procedures

When collecting blood samples from patients, it is crucial to follow proper collection procedures to prevent contamination and ensure the integrity of the samples. The following protocols should be followed during the blood collection process:

Key points to remember:

  1. Verify the patient's identity before collecting the blood sample.
  2. Use sterile equipment, such as needles and collection tubes, to prevent contamination.
  3. Select the appropriate site for blood collection based on the type of test being performed.
  4. Follow the correct order of draw when collecting multiple blood samples to avoid Cross-Contamination.

Processing and Handling

Once the blood samples have been collected, they need to be processed and handled with care to ensure accurate and reliable results. The following protocols should be followed during the processing and handling of blood samples:

Key points to remember:

  1. Label each blood sample with the patient's information to avoid mix-ups.
  2. Properly store the blood samples at the correct temperature to maintain their integrity.
  3. Centrifuge the blood samples according to the specific requirements of the tests being performed.
  4. Handle the blood samples with care to prevent hemolysis or contamination.

Quality Control and Assurance

Quality Control and assurance are essential aspects of maintaining the accuracy and reliability of blood sample analysis in a medical laboratory setting. The following protocols should be followed to ensure Quality Control and assurance:

Key points to remember:

  1. Regularly calibrate and maintain lab equipment to ensure accurate results.
  2. Participate in Proficiency Testing programs to monitor the laboratory's performance.
  3. Document all Quality Control procedures and results for reference and review.
